Why are there Slovaks in Serbia?

The modern Slovaks in Vojvodina are descendants of 18th- and 19th-century settlers, who migrated from the territory of present-day Slovakia.

Are Serbia and Hungary friends?

Hungary and Serbia share a long historical contact, but both have been characterized between cooperation and conflict. After the war, Hungary lost Vojvodina, a former territory of the Kingdom of Hungary, to Serbia. Hungary signed a non-aggression and “Treaty of Eternal Friendship” with Yugoslavia on 12 December 1940.

How many Serbs live in Hungary?

7,210 people
The Serbs in Hungary (Hungarian: Magyarországi szerbek, Serbian: Срби у Мађарској / Srbi u Mađarskoj) are recognized as an ethnic minority, numbering 7,210 people or 0.1\% of the total population (2011 census).

How many Serbs are there in the world?

2 million Serbs
There are over 2 million Serbs in diaspora throughout the world; some sources put that figure as high as 4 million. There is a large diaspora in Western Europe, particularly in Germany, Austria, Switzerland, France, Italy, Sweden and United Kingdom.

Are Hungarians depressed?

Suffering from depression This article is also bringing bad news. Hungary has the highest rate of people suffering from depression in Europe: 10.5\% of the adult population report experiencing depressive symptoms, compared to an EU average of 6.8\%, according to a thorough Eurostat survey.

Who are the Hungarians in Serbia?

Hungarians are the second largest ethnic group in Serbia if not counting Kosovo. According to the 2011 census, there are 253,899 ethnic Hungarians composing 3.5\% of the population of Serbia. The majority of them live in the northern province of Vojvodina, where they number 251,136 or 13\% of the population of the province.
